Jay (Wade Radford) has never gotten over his last breakup - and it's
not just that he's drowning in self-pity and tries to wash the painful
memories away with alcohol, his ex (Robbie Manners) even appears to him in
his dreams, as a ghost who tries to worm his way back into Jay's life. But
as heart-broken as the break-up left Jay, he won't take his ex back,
leaving him in a catch 22 situation ... Caught in a
Landslide is not much of a narrative movie - and I mean this in the
best possible way, as it approaches its story in a very lyrical way,
paints the emotions of the characters in impressive pictures rather than
through action, features long stretches of Wade Radford's own poetry to
create the proper atmosphere, and gives its cast of two plenty of air to
portray their feelings. A rather unusual movie, but well worth a look!
